Why Smart Thermostats Matter for Energy Savings

 

Smart thermostats are capable of more than merely controlling the temperature in your house.  They learn your habits, optimize energy usage, and even adjust settings based on weather conditions. According to studies, households can reduce their annual heating and cooling costs by up to 10% to 15% by implementing a smart thermostat. They’re an investment in both your comfort and the environment.

1. Google Nest Learning Thermostat (4th Gen)

 

Why It’s Great:

The Google Nest Learning Thermostat is a top performer for energy savings. It learns your schedule within days and adjusts temperatures automatically to optimize comfort and efficiency. With its intuitive app, you can control it remotely and receive detailed reports on your energy usage.


Key Features:


  • ·         Auto-schedule learning technology
  • ·         Compatibility with 95% of HVAC systems
  • ·         Energy usage tracking via the Nest app
  • ·         Works with Alexa and Google Assistant
  • ·         Potential Energy Savings: 15% on heating and cooling
  • ·         Price: Around $250

 

2. Eco bee Smart Thermostat Premium

 

Why It’s Great:

Eco bee’s Smart Thermostat Premium goes beyond temperature control, acting as a full-fledged smart home hub. Its built-in voice control (Alexa and Siri) and smart sensor technology ensure even greater savings by managing hot and cold spots in your home.


Key Features:


  • ·         Smart sensors for room-specific adjustments
  • ·         Built-in Alexa and Siri support
  • ·         Energy Star certified for efficiency
  • ·         Monthly energy reports
  • ·         Energy Savings Potential: Up to 23% annually
  • ·         Price: Around $300

 

3. Honeywell Home T9 Smart Thermostat

 

Why It’s Great:

The Honeywell T9 Smart Thermostat is designed for families with dynamic schedules. Its remote room sensors help prioritize comfort where it’s needed most, ensuring efficient energy usage across your home.

 

Key Features:


  • ·         Smart room sensors for focused adjustments
  • ·         Customizable temperature schedules
  • ·         Works with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ple HomeKit
  • ·         Easy-to-read touchscreen interface
  • ·         Energy Savings Potential: Up to 12% annually
  • ·         Price: Around $199

 

4. Amazon Smart Thermostat

 

Why It’s Great:

Amazon’s budget-friendly smart thermostat is ideal for first-time users. Designed in collaboration with Honeywell, it integrates seamlessly with Alexa for voice control and app-based adjustments.

 

Key Features:


  • ·         Alexa integration
  • ·         Minimalist, eco-friendly design
  • ·         Energy usage reports in the Alexa app
  • ·         Affordable pricing
  • ·         Energy Savings Potential: Around 10% annually
  • ·         Price: Around $75

 

5. Tado° Smart Thermostat V3+

 

Why It’s Great:

Tado° focuses on sustainability and precision. Its geofencing feature adjusts settings when no one is home, maximizing energy efficiency. The thermostat also offers actionable advice to reduce consumption further.

 

Key Features:


  • ·         Geofencing for automatic adjustments
  • ·         Smart scheduling and open window detection
  • ·         Energy-saving reports and recommendations
  • ·         Works with major smart home systems
  • ·         Energy Savings Potential: Up to 22% annually
  • ·         Price: Around $230

How Smart Thermostats Deliver Energy Savings

 

·         Learning Algorithms: Adapt to your daily routine to minimize unnecessary energy usage.

·         Geofencing Technology: Automatically adjust settings based on whether you're home or away.

·         Real-Time Data: Offer insights into your energy habits for better decision-making.

·         Integration: Work with other smart devices to optimize your entire home’s energy consumption.

 

 

Tips to Maximize Energy Savings

 

·         Set Realistic Temperature Goals: Avoid extreme settings to reduce strain on your HVAC system.

·         Use Smart Scheduling: Program the thermostat to adjust during off-peak hours.

·         Monitor Usage Reports: Take advantage of the analytics offered by smart thermostats.

·         Regular Maintenance: Keep your HVAC system clean and serviced for optimal performance.

·         Take Advantage of Rebates: Many energy companies offer incentives for upgrading to smart thermostats.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

 

1. How much can a smart thermostat save me?

Smart thermostats can typically save you 10 to 20 percent yearly on heating and cooling expenses. The exact savings depend on your home's size, insulation, and your energy usage habits.

 

2. Are smart thermostats difficult to install?

The majority of smart thermostats come with comprehensive instructions and are intended for do-it-yourself installation. Professional installation is advised, nevertheless, if wiring bothers you or you're not sure if your HVAC system is compatible.

 

3. Can a smart thermostat work without Wi-Fi?

While basic thermostat functions will work without Wi-Fi, features like remote control, energy reports, and software updates require an active internet connection.

 

4. Do all HVAC systems work with smart thermostats?

Not all smart thermostats are universally compatible. Before purchasing, check the manufacturer’s compatibility guide to ensure it works with your specific system.

 

5. What distinguishes a programmed thermostat from a smart thermostat?

A programmable thermostat lets you set schedules manually, while a smart thermostat learns your habits, adjusts settings automatically, and provides energy usage insights. For extra convenience, smart thermostats can be integrated with smart home systems.

 

6. Are there any rebates or incentives for purchasing a smart thermostat?

Many utility companies offer rebates or discounts for upgrading to a smart thermostat. Check with your local energy provider for available programs.

 

7. Can smart thermostats improve my home's carbon footprint?

Yes! By optimizing energy usage and reducing waste, smart thermostats lower your energy consumption, which in turn reduces your carbon emissions.
